Giving presentations can be a great marketing tool to build credibility and attract a following. Sure, but what does that mean for you? Learn:
  • How do you know if you're cut out to be a speaker

  • When you should say "yes" to a speaking opportunity

  • What event planners look for in a presenter

Leave with more direction and confidence about whether presenting is the right fit for you and if so, how to go about it. Who knows? Maybe the spotlight is waiting for you!


Devie HagenPresenter: Devie Hagen, Elan Speakers Agency

Devie Hagen started in the hospitality industry back in the 70’s.  She was a meeting planner at Medtronic for 13 years.  When she accepted a position to the United Way as a loaned executive she decided to make the career change and go into hospitality sales.  She spent 22 years at national hotel/resort companies (Hilton Int’l, Benchmark Hospitality, Riverwood Inn & Conference Center, Dolce Int’l, & Madden’s Resort) moving to Vice President/General Manager after consistently exceeding revenue targets.  She is actively involved in numerous associations and has been honored to receive numerous awards for leadership, achievement, mentorship, sales and positive attitude from Dolce, Hilton, MN MPI, Mn Meetings & Events, NCBTA, the Benchmark Bulldog Award and the MN Film Board.

Devie has moved into a new career in hospitality as an agent for speakers & presenters with Elan Speakers Agency seeing a great need to partner with meeting planners ensuring they get that “right fit” for their audience.  Elan means inspirational, vivacious, classic.  She truly believes that partnering and supporting each other is the best success.
